COEFFICIENT INDICATION FOR CHANNEL STATE INFORMATION

    Abstract: Methods, systems, and devices for wireless communications are described. A user equipment (UE) may perform channel state information measurements on reference signal transmissions from a base station. The UE may identify a set of cross layer coefficients associated with a set of spatial layers based on the channel state information measurements. The UE may additionally identify a set of precoding coefficients associated with a spatial layer from the set of spatial layers. In some implementations, the set of precoding coefficients may be based on the set of cross layer coefficients. In some examples, the UE may transmit the set of cross layer coefficients and the set of precoding coefficients to the base station.

    POLAR CODE CONSTRUCTION FOR INCREMENTAL REDUNDANCY

    Abstract: A device may identify that an incremental redundancy hybrid automatic repeat request (IR-HARQ) scheme is used in association with sequential transmissions of an information bit vector to or from another wireless device, where each transmission in the scheme is associated with a resource size. The device may identify a mother code length for a polar code based at least in part on an aggregate resource size associated with the sequential transmissions. The device may identify an adjusted bit index set for the polar code based at least in part on the IR-HARQ scheme. The device may transmit (or receive), for each transmission of the information bit vector, a respective subset of encoded bits generated by mapping the information bit vector to a set of polarized bit channels of the polar code in accordance with the bit index set.

    POLAR CODED HYBRID AUTOMATIC REPEAT REQUEST (HARQ) WITH INCREMENTAL CHANNEL POLARIZATION

    Abstract: Various aspects of the present disclosure generally relate to wireless communication. In some aspects, a wireless communication device may perform a first polar code encoding process on a first transmission of a hybrid automatic repeat request (HARQ) process; generate a second transmission of the HARQ process by relocating a portion of bits in less reliable positions of the first transmission to more reliable positions of the second transmission of the HARQ process, wherein the less reliable positions and the more reliable positions are evaluated based at least in part on a channel transform, wherein the channel transform is based at least in part on the first transmission, the second transmission, the first polar encoding process and a second polar encoding process associated with the second transmission; and transmit the second transmission of the HARQ process.     ENHANCED TRANSMISSION TIME INTERVAL BUNDLING DESIGN FOR MACHINE TYPE COMMUNICATIONS

    Abstract: Aspects of the present disclosure provide techniques for enhanced transmission time interval (TTI) bundling design for machine type communications (MTC). A method for wireless communications by a wireless device is provided. The method generally includes determining a mapping of one or more uplink or downlink channels to one or more fixed bundling sizes, wherein each of the one or more fixed bundling sizes indicates a number of transmission time intervals (TTIs) over which a channel should be transmitted and processing transmission of the one or more uplink or downlink channels based on the mapping.
